Easy Mediterranean Cauliflower Rice Skillet (Healthy One-Pan Meal)

Ingredients List
For the Skillet
- 3 cups cauliflower rice (fresh or frozen)
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 1 small onion, diced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1 small zucchini, diced
- ½ cup bell pepper, chopped
- ¼ cup Kalamata olives, sliced
- ½ tsp salt
- ¼ tsp black pepper
- ½ tsp dried oregano
- ¼ tsp paprika
For Finishing
- ¼ cup crumbled feta cheese
- 1–2 tbsp fresh lemon juice
- 2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ped
Optional Add-Ins
- Cooked chicken, shrimp, or chickpeas for protein
- Spinach or kale for extra greens
Ingredient Tip: Fresh cauliflower rice has a firmer texture, while frozen is convenient—just thaw and drain excess moisture before cooking.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Sauté Aromatics
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
Add onion and cook for 3–4 minutes until soft. Add garlic and sauté for another minute until fragrant.
Step 2: Cook Vegetables
Add:
- cherry tomatoes
- zucchini
- bell pepper
Cook for 5–6 minutes, stirring occasionally, until vegetables are tender but still slightly crisp.
Step 3: Add Cauliflower Rice
Stir in cauliflower rice, salt, pepper, oregano, and paprika.
Cook for 5–7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until heated through and slightly golden.
Step 4: Add Mediterranean Flavors
Stir in:
- sliced olives
- fresh lemon juice
Mix well to combine all flavors.
Step 5: Finish and Serve
Remove from heat and top with:
- crumbled feta cheese
- chopped parsley
Serve warm as a main dish or side.

Nutritional Information
Approximate values per serving (4 servings):
| Nutrient | Amount |
|---|---|
| Calories | 160 kcal |
| Protein | 6 g |
| Carbohydrates | 12 g |
| Fat | 10 g |
| Fiber | 4 g |

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Overcooking cauliflower rice: Can become mushy—cook just until tender.
- Not draining frozen cauliflower: Excess moisture can make the dish watery.
- Skipping lemon juice: Adds essential brightness and balance.
- Overcrowding the pan: Use a large skillet for even cooking.
Storing Tips for the Recipe
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.
- Reheat in a skillet or microwave until warm.
- Not ideal for freezing, as cauliflower texture may soften too much.
